As of April 24, 2026, there is one approved Public Housing unit available at Scattered Sites, an affordable housing development in Apple Valley, California. Rental prices vary from $455 to $991 and are available to low-income individuals who fulfill the income criteria and other eligibility requirements.
*Rent estimates are calculated using San Bernardino County Fair Market Rents for 2026 and assume the 30% extremely low income threshold is met. This means that the tenant will be responsible for 30% of the Fair Market Rent for this unit. It is recommended to contact the Housing Authority of the City of Needles for exact rent pricing.
